A rare Catalan (Barcelona) façon de Venise cruet or apothecary flask, late 16th century

In distinctive straw-yellow coloured metal, the ovoid body striped with fine vertical latticinio threads and with a slender neck enclosed at the top where a blue glass trail and blue finial are applied, the double loop handle and flattened pointed spout also with fine white stripes, a trailed ring foot at the base and a further blue glass trail on the spout tip, 16cm high

Footnotes

Provenance:
Property of an Italian Noblewoman

A very similar example with latticinio stripes, in the Collection of The Hispanic Society of America is illustrated by Alice Wilson Frothingham, Hispanic Glass (1941), p.40, fig.27. Another in the Bayerischen Nationalmuseum, Munich is illustrated by Rainer Ruckert, Die Glassammling (1982), vol.1, pl.X, fig.123. Others of the same distinctive form just in clear glass or with white trailed loops are in the collection at Veste Coburg see Anna-Elisabeth Theuerkauff-Liederwald's Catalogue (1994), pp.381-2, figs.411-414. A further example with combed white loops is in the Musée de Cluny, see Alice Wilson Frothingham, Spanish Glass (1963), pl.32A.
